Output d8571528ca05b5d0561b34ca0bf0b6a5f0041b47d43f87d3ecb2e61d7f785228:1

value
996889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c241adf018577fa5c2d2b5f3d99d73a67af10a7 OP_EQUAL
address
3D1QxwvJ7oXLgkCmvHXRDjgADY9s5op8TP
transaction
d8571528ca05b5d0561b34ca0bf0b6a5f0041b47d43f87d3ecb2e61d7f785228
spent
true